Using a UAS for photography offers significant advantages, with one of the most prominent being the ability to capture aerial perspectives that are otherwise difficult or impossible to achieve. This unique vantage point allows photographers to explore angles and compositions that ground-based photography simply cannot provide. For instance, capturing vast landscapes, urban environments, and wildlife from above can reveal detail and context that enhances storytelling and visual impact.

Aerial photography can showcase the scale of structures or natural formations, offer unique patterns in landscapes that are visible only from the sky, and provide an immersive experience for viewers. This capability is part of what makes UAS photography especially valuable across various industries, including real estate, agriculture, and environmental monitoring.
